Lisa's Best Ever Garlic Bread

INGREDIENTS

  • Main Ingredients

    • 🧈 ½ cup butter
    • šŸ§„ 3 cloves garlic, sliced
    • šŸž 1 (16 ounce) loaf French bread, halved lengthwise

STEPS

1

Melt butter in a small saucepan; simmer garlic slices in hot butter over low heat until butter turns foamy, about 5 minutes.

2

Set oven rack about 6 inches from the heat source and preheat the oven's broiler.

3

Place bread loaf halves under the preheated broiler to toast, 2 to 4 minutes. Watch carefully to prevent burning.

4

Slice toasted bread into 2-inch thick slices. Dip toasted side of each slice into garlic butter.

šŸ’” Tips

Watch the bread closely under the broiler to prevent burning.For an extra flavor boost, sprinkle shredded parmesan on the bread before broiling.This dish pairs wonderfully with pasta or a fresh salad.Leftover garlic butter can be refrigerated and reused for other dishes.
